#f4d4b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4d4b8 is composed of 95.7% red, 83.1%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 24.6%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 83.9%. #f4d4b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e9a971.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#f4d4b8 color description : Very soft orange.
#f4d4b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4d4b8 has RGB values of R:244, G:212,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.25,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16045240.
